2011-09-13 12 views
0

私はSilverlightを使用しているクライアントのLOBアプリケーションで作業しています。silverlightを使用してレジストリに書き込みますか?

このアプリケーションの要件の1つは、ユーザーレジストリに、別のアーキテクチャーで使用される値を書き込むことです。

これはおそらくいくつかの人々のための警鐘を発生させるが、これは可能です..それは銀色で行うことができない場合は、(アクティブxおそらく)それを行う別の方法がありますか?

答えて

1

信頼できるアプリケーションの場合は、レジストリに読み書きできます。レジストリへの書き込みは、HKEYの現在のユーザーに限られます。

ジャスティン・エンジェルスからのすばらしいポストで、たくさんの「隠された宝石」が展示されます。

http://justinangel.net/CuttingEdgeSilverlight4ComFeatures

いくつかのコード:

  using (dynamic shell = AutomationFactory.CreateObject("WScript.Shell")) 
      {      

       shell.RegWrite(@"HKCU\Software\Classes\...", ...); 

乾杯 ブラウリオ

+0

おかげブラウリオ..あなたはクッキーを取得!私の上司は、最終的にユーザーのマシンにレジストリキーを取得するためのより良いソリューションをdeicided ...私は怖い必要があるかどうかはわからない:P –

関連する問題